WebThe Northern Flicker (Colaptes auratus) is a species of woodpecker that can be found in North America. It has a wide geographic range and inhabits many different habitats, from deciduous forests to mountain ranges. Its preferred habitat consists of open areas with trees or shrubs for nesting and feeding, such as grasslands and meadows.
Web3. Males and females look similar with only a few differences. Male and female Northern Flickers have similar plumage. They both have a U-shaped black patch on their breast feathers. Their wings have black bars, and their chest and belly are covered in black spots. In flight, you can see a white patch above the tail.
